#include <Texture/TexturePCH.h> #include <Foundation/IO/FileSystem/FileReader.h> #include <Foundation/IO/FileSystem/FileWriter.h> #include <Texture/Utils/TextureAtlasDesc.h> ezResult ezTextureAtlasCreationDesc::Serialize(ezStreamWriter& inout_stream) const { inout_stream.WriteVersion(4); if (m_Layers.GetCount() > 255u) return EZ_FAILURE; const ezUInt8 uiNumLayers = static_cast<ezUInt8>(m_Layers.GetCount()); inout_stream << uiNumLayers; for (ezUInt32 l = 0; l < uiNumLayers; ++l) { inout_stream << m_Layers[l].m_Usage; inout_stream << m_Layers[l].m_uiNumChannels; } inout_stream << m_Items.GetCount(); for (auto& item : m_Items) { inout_stream << item.m_uiUniqueID; inout_stream << item.m_uiFlags; for (ezUInt32 l = 0; l < uiNumLayers; ++l) { inout_stream << item.m_sLayerInput[l]; } inout_stream << item.m_sAlphaInput; inout_stream << item.m_uiNumVariationsX; inout_stream << item.m_uiNumVariationsY; } return EZ_SUCCESS; } ezResult ezTextureAtlasCreationDesc::Deserialize(ezStreamReader& inout_stream) { const ezTypeVersion uiVersion = inout_stream.ReadVersion(4); ezUInt8 uiNumLayers = 0; inout_stream >> uiNumLayers; m_Layers.SetCount(uiNumLayers); for (ezUInt32 l = 0; l < uiNumLayers; ++l) { inout_stream >> m_Layers[l].m_Usage; inout_stream >> m_Layers[l].m_uiNumChannels; } ezUInt32 uiNumItems = 0; inout_stream >> uiNumItems; m_Items.SetCount(uiNumItems); for (auto& item : m_Items) { inout_stream >> item.m_uiUniqueID; inout_stream >> item.m_uiFlags; for (ezUInt32 l = 0; l < uiNumLayers; ++l) { inout_stream >> item.m_sLayerInput[l]; } if (uiVersion >= 3) { inout_stream >> item.m_sAlphaInput; } if (uiVersion >= 4) { inout_stream >> item.m_uiNumVariationsX; inout_stream >> item.m_uiNumVariationsY; } } return EZ_SUCCESS; } ezResult ezTextureAtlasCreationDesc::Save(ezStringView sFile) const { ezFileWriter file; EZ_SUCCEED_OR_RETURN(file.Open(sFile)); return Serialize(file); } ezResult ezTextureAtlasCreationDesc::Load(ezStringView sFile) { ezFileReader file; EZ_SUCCEED_OR_RETURN(file.Open(sFile)); return Deserialize(file); } void ezTextureAtlasRuntimeDesc::Clear() { m_uiNumLayers = 0; m_Items.Clear(); } ezResult ezTextureAtlasRuntimeDesc::Serialize(ezStreamWriter& inout_stream) const { m_Items.Sort(); inout_stream.WriteVersion(2); inout_stream << m_uiNumLayers; inout_stream << m_Items.GetCount(); for (ezUInt32 i = 0; i < m_Items.GetCount(); ++i) { inout_stream << m_Items.GetKey(i); inout_stream << m_Items.GetValue(i).m_uiFlags; for (ezUInt32 l = 0; l < m_uiNumLayers; ++l) { const auto& r = m_Items.GetValue(i).m_LayerRects[l]; inout_stream << r.x; inout_stream << r.y; inout_stream << r.width; inout_stream << r.height; } inout_stream << m_Items.GetValue(i).m_uiNumVariationsX; inout_stream << m_Items.GetValue(i).m_uiNumVariationsY; } return EZ_SUCCESS; } ezResult ezTextureAtlasRuntimeDesc::Deserialize(ezStreamReader& inout_stream) { Clear(); const ezTypeVersion uiVersion = inout_stream.ReadVersion(2); inout_stream >> m_uiNumLayers; ezUInt32 uiNumItems = 0; inout_stream >> uiNumItems; m_Items.Reserve(uiNumItems); for (ezUInt32 i = 0; i < uiNumItems; ++i) { ezUInt32 key = 0; inout_stream >> key; auto& item = m_Items[key]; inout_stream >> item.m_uiFlags; for (ezUInt32 l = 0; l < m_uiNumLayers; ++l) { auto& r = item.m_LayerRects[l]; inout_stream >> r.x; inout_stream >> r.y; inout_stream >> r.width; inout_stream >> r.height; } if (uiVersion >= 2) { inout_stream >> item.m_uiNumVariationsX; inout_stream >> item.m_uiNumVariationsY; } } m_Items.Sort(); return EZ_SUCCESS; }
